What is a Link?
A link, commonly referred to as a hyperlink, is a reference to data that users can follow by clicking or tapping. Links are essential elements of the web; they connect various web pages and enable navigation. Understanding the mechanics of links is crucial for anyone involved in digital marketing or web development.
The Role of Links in SEO
Links play a vital role in Search Engine Optimization (SEO). They are one of the primary factors that search engines use to determine the relevance and authority of web pages. For instance, having high-quality inbound links from well-regarded sites enhances a page’s credibility and improves its ranking in search engine results. Types of Links
There are various types of links, each serving a unique purpose. Internal links connect different pages within the same website and help with site navigation and hierarchy. External links point to other websites, sharing authority and credibility. On the other hand, backlinks are incoming links from outside sources, reflecting the strength and relevance of your content. Understanding these distinctions allows marketers to optimize their link strategies effectively.
Link Building Strategies
Effective link building is critical for enhancing domain authority and increasing organic traffic. One common strategy is guest blogging, where you write articles for other blogs in your niche and include links back to your site. Another technique is to create shareable content, such as informative articles or engaging infographics, which naturally attracts links from other sites. Furthermore, reaching out to influencers and industry leaders can facilitate link opportunities that bolster your online presence.
